Kia Sorento maintenance: the schedule, the costs, the traps
A midsize 3-row SUV with a gas powertrain. Below: the service intervals with real cost ranges, the repairs Sorento owners actually report, and when a fleet operator would sell. Same data Carlyle uses to score fleet buys.
Service schedule
What it needs, and what that runs
| Interval | Service | Typical cost |
|---|---|---|
| 7,500 mi / 12 mo | Synthetic oil & filter; tire rotation; multi-point inspection | $75-$140 |
| 15,000 mi | Oil & filter; rotation; cabin air filter | $130-$220 |
| 30,000 mi | Oil & filter; rotation; engine air filter; cabin filter; brake fluid; inspect | $260-$470 |
| 45,000 mi | Oil & filter; rotation; spark plugs (2.5T turbo) | $280-$500 |
| 60,000 mi | Oil & filter; rotation; air filters; brake fluid; DCT/auto trans fluid; AWD transfer-case & rear-diff fluid | $450-$800 |
| 97,500 mi | Spark plugs (2.5L NA); engine coolant (first 120k); trans service | $350-$650 |
Known repair windows
What Sorento owners actually run into
Mileage ranges where these repairs typically show up. Buying above a window is not automatically a pass - it just needs to be priced in.
2.5T 8-speed wet DCT electric oil-pump failure / power loss
high severity20,000-80,000 mi · $0 under recall, else $3,000-$5,000
Recall 22V-760/SC on 2021-2022 2.5T; sudden motive-power loss, transmission replacement.
2.5L GDI carbon buildup / high-pressure fuel pump
medium severity70,000-120,000 mi · $500-$1,200
Direct-injection deposits; rough idle/misfire.
Turbo (2.5T) engine oil consumption (early builds)
medium severity40,000-100,000 mi · $500-$3,000
Monitor consumption; some short-block claims.
AC condenser failure
medium severity50,000-100,000 mi · $600-$1,100
Common Kia weak point.
Panoramic sunroof rattle / water leak
low severity20,000-80,000 mi · $200-$800
Drain-tube clogging, wind noise.
Idle stop-start / 12V battery
low severity40,000-70,000 mi · $200-$400
AGM battery; ISG faults when weak.
Operator notes
MQ4 generation (2021+, facelift 2024). Base 2.5L NA uses an 8-speed torque-converter auto; 2.5T turbo uses an 8-speed WET dual-clutch (DCT) needing periodic fluid service. Timing chain. Coolant first 120k. Brake fluid every 2 yr. Current model year on sale.
When the smart money sells
On fleet math, a gas Sorento retires around 95,000 miles - but the exit window opens earlier here: 2.5T 8-speed wet DCT electric oil-pump failure / power loss risk window ($0 under recall, else $3,000-$5,000) opens ~20,000 mi. Carlyle's garage tracks this per car, against your actual odometer.
